Jaime Bradley provided special comments for ABC’s coverage of AFLW clash between North Melbourne and Western Bulldogs at Launceston last night. Jaime was a premiership player-coach for Burnie Dockers in Tasmanian Women’s League in 2016, and married teammate Britt Gibson (who went on to play for Brisbane Lions before joining the Kangaroos in off season in 2018) in November 2018.

Crocmedia and SEN’s coverage of 2019 AFL season began tonight with the pre-season match between Carlton and Essendon at Ikon Park. AFL Nation and SEN will broadcasts every JLT Community Series match live, with selected matches also covered by 3AW, FiveAA, 6PR and Triple M.

Melbourne’s Joy FM will broadcast Sunday’s AFLW clash between Western Bulldogs and Carlton - the second annual Pride Game - from Whitten Oval.


The match will also be broadcast on ABC Grandstand Digital and online (ABC Radio Melbourne is covering game 4 of NBL Grand Final Series between Melbourne United and Perth Wildcats which overlaps with first half of AFLW).
